Chemical Peels
Chemical peels use gentle acids to remove dead skin cells. As a result, your skin looks brighter and smoother. These peels can also help with uneven tone and fine lines. Most people notice a fresh glow within a few days. However, it’s important to choose the right peel for your skin type.
Microdermabrasion
Microdermabrasion is a safe pre-event facial treatment. It uses tiny crystals to polish the skin’s surface. This process removes dull, dry skin and reveals a healthy layer underneath. In addition, it can improve texture and help makeup go on smoothly.
Hydrafacial
Hydrafacial is a gentle, three-step treatment. First, it cleanses the skin. Next, it exfoliates and removes impurities. Finally, it hydrates with special serums. Many people love this treatment because it gives instant results with no downtime.
Laser Skin Rejuvenation
Laser treatments use light energy to boost collagen and even out skin tone. These dermatologist glow up procedures can reduce spots, redness, and fine lines. While some lasers need more recovery time, others offer quick results for a pre-event glow.
LED Light Therapy
LED light therapy uses safe, gentle lights to calm the skin and reduce redness. It can also help with acne and boost your skin’s natural glow. This treatment is painless and has no downtime, making it a great quick skin glow solution.
Injectable Boosters (e.g., Skin Boosters, Fillers)
Some people choose injectable boosters for extra radiance. Skin boosters add moisture and plumpness, while fillers can smooth lines. These treatments should always be done by a board-certified dermatologist for safety and best results.
How to Choose the Right Treatment for Your Skin Type
Not every treatment suits every skin type. Therefore, it’s important to talk to a dermatologist. They will check your skin and suggest the best options. For example:Oily skin may benefit from chemical peels or microdermabrasion.Dry or sensitive skin often does well with Hydrafacial or LED therapy.Mature skin may need laser rejuvenation or injectable boosters.
Always share your skin concerns and any allergies with your doctor.
Safety, Side Effects, and Recovery Tips
Most professional treatments for pre-event glow are safe when done by experts. Still, you may notice mild redness, swelling, or peeling. These effects usually fade within a few days. To stay safe, follow these tips:Choose a board-certified dermatologist.Ask about possible side effects and recovery time.Avoid sun exposure after your treatment.Follow all aftercare instructions closely.

Pre- and Post-Treatment Skincare Guidance
Proper skincare before and after your treatment helps you get the best glow. Here are some simple tips:Before treatment, avoid harsh scrubs or new products.Keep your skin clean and moisturized.After treatment, use gentle cleansers and sunscreen daily.Do not pick or scratch your skin as it heals.Stay hydrated and eat a balanced diet for healthy skin.
These steps can help your skin recover faster and look its best.
